Output 6e98d673e8f76a32d247bb9d9a4f30e61de9a5fae0b6ce4d946ed244cd0c6a76:0

value
449500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77fab5320bda6ecd338af26869a749fb35fca819 OP_EQUAL
address
3CdQfrWx4haa9mTc355ZNF3obqtDz3rvjc
transaction
6e98d673e8f76a32d247bb9d9a4f30e61de9a5fae0b6ce4d946ed244cd0c6a76
spent
true